    Eastern Sun was founded in 1966 [1] by Aw Kow, the son of Tiger Balm founder Aw Boon Haw, using HK$3 million that he borrowed from a communist news agency based in Hong Kong. [2] In return, Aw had to repay the loan at a "ridiculously low rate interest of 0.1 percent per annum". [3] Soon after the newspaper started, they faced financial problems.

    Oriental Daily News is a Chinese-language newspaper in Hong Kong. It was established in 1969 by Ma Sik-yu and Ma Sik-chun, and was one of the two newspapers published by the Oriental Press Group Limited (Chinese: 東方報業集團有限公司).     The South China Morning Post (SCMP), with its Sunday edition, the Sunday Morning Post, is a Hong Kong-based English-language newspaper owned by Alibaba Group. [2] [3] Founded in 1903 by Tse Tsan-tai and Alfred Cunningham, it has remained Hong Kong's newspaper of record since British colonial rule.
